Streaming sticks and built-in TV applications do not possess the dual-decoder hardware required to process the EL. When faced with a Profile 7 file in an MKV container, devices like the Apple TV running Infuse or Plex will choke, dropping the video entirely back to static HDR10. The Solution: Profile 8.1
